While legitimate services like Amazon Prime, Hulu, and HBO Max have polished interfaces and legal departments, the sites that rank for terms like "HD4U" operate differently. They are part of a vast, shifting ecosystem known as "pirate" or "torrent" sites.

The "Whack-a-Mole" Strategy Sites that host unauthorized copies of Hollywood movies rarely stay in one place. Because of strict copyright enforcement by major studios, these domains are frequently seized or blocked by Internet Service Providers (ISPs). Consequently, the operators use a strategy of domain hopping. If hd4u.com is seized, the site might reappear as hd4u.net, hd4u.watch, or hd4u.xyz.

The User Experience For the user, these sites often promise a utopia of free content. However, the reality is often fraught with risks. The interface is typically cluttered with aggressive pop-up advertisements, some of which can lead to malicious software (malware). The video quality varies wildly; a film labeled "HD" might actually be a "CAM rip" (a video recorded by a camera inside a movie theater), resulting in poor audio and shaky visuals.

What "HD4U Movie Hollywood" Suggests The phrase combines three powerful signals. "HD" promises high-definition quality, a baseline expectation for modern viewers. "4U" implies user-focused convenience and immediacy—content curated or delivered directly to an individual. "Movie Hollywood" signals mainstream, big-studio productions: star-driven narratives, large budgets, and global distribution. Together the name evokes a one-stop destination for premium, high-quality Hollywood films available on demand.

Consumer Appeal and Market Demand Audiences want easy, affordable access to films in the best available formats. Streaming services succeeded because they combined vast catalogs, personalization, device compatibility, and predictable pricing. For many viewers, especially younger demographics, ownership has been replaced by access: paying for convenience and a frictionless experience rather than maintaining local libraries of physical media. A platform promising HD Hollywood movies tailored "for you" would thus meet clear market demand—if it provides an intuitive interface, reliable playback, and a content library perceived as valuable.

Legal and Ethical Considerations A central issue for any platform presenting Hollywood movies is licensing. Major studios tightly control distribution rights and monetize them through theatrical releases, pay-TV windows, transactional rentals, and licensed streaming. Legal services secure rights and pay royalties; unauthorized platforms that host or link to pirated copies undermine creators’ revenue and expose users to legal and cybersecurity risks. The proliferation of sites offering “HD” Hollywood films for free has prompted anti-piracy enforcement, takedown requests, and sometimes criminal charges. Ethical use of online platforms involves choosing licensed services that compensate creators and rights holders.

Technological Challenges and Quality Expectations Delivering HD-quality films requires robust infrastructure: efficient encoding to preserve picture and audio fidelity, adaptive streaming for varying bandwidths, content delivery networks (CDNs) to reduce latency, and DRM (digital rights management) to protect licensed assets. Users expect seamless playback across devices—smart TVs, phones, tablets—and features such as subtitles, multiple audio tracks, and recommended content. Services that cut corners produce poor experiences (stuttering, artifacts, broken links) that damage trust even if content is legally obtained.

Business Models and Competition Several sustainable business models exist: subscription (SVOD), transactional (TVOD), ad-supported (AVOD), and hybrid approaches. Major incumbents compete on exclusive content, user experience, and global reach. Niche platforms may find success by specializing—restorations, classic Hollywood, director-focused catalogs—or by bundling value-added services. Any new entrant invoking Hollywood must navigate licensing costs, marketing to differentiate itself, and the long game of building subscriber loyalty.

Cultural Impacts Hollywood films shape global narratives and cultural imaginations. Democratized access broadens audiences and cultural exchange but also raises concerns about homogenization—where blockbuster-driven platforms crowd out local or independent voices. Curated platforms that emphasize diversity, contextual curation, and discoverability can help preserve a broader film ecosystem.

Risks of Unlicensed Services Platforms promising free HD access to mainstream films often obtain content illicitly. Beyond legal exposure, users of such services risk malware, intrusive ads, and low-quality files that do not match the HD promise. Additionally, such services erode the financial base that funds future filmmaking, especially for projects that do not have guaranteed blockbuster returns.

To understand the allure of a platform like HD4U, one must first understand the modern viewer. The site’s name itself—"HD4U" (High Definition For You)—is a masterclass in marketing to the digital consumer. It promises quality (High Definition) and personalization (For You), directly addressing the two primary concerns of the modern streamer: visual fidelity and ease of access. For many global audiences, particularly those in regions where subscription costs for multiple platforms like Netflix, Disney+, or HBO Max are prohibitive, sites like HD4U serve as a necessary bridge. They democratize access to Hollywood culture, allowing individuals to participate in global conversations about films like Avatar or Oppenheimer without the barrier of entry imposed by expensive cinema tickets or monthly subscription fees.

However, the existence of such platforms poses an existential threat to the traditional Hollywood economic model. Hollywood is an industry built on massive financial risks; a single blockbuster can cost hundreds of millions of dollars to produce and market. The return on investment relies heavily on box office receipts and licensed streaming revenue. When platforms like HD4U offer this content for free, they bypass the legal channels that fund the art itself. This creates a parasitic relationship where the audience consumes the product without contributing to the ecosystem that created it. Industry advocates argue that this piracy undercuts the profitability of mid-budget films and original screenplays, forcing studios to rely increasingly on safe, franchise-driven intellectual properties (IPs) that are guaranteed to draw crowds to theaters, stifling creativity in the process.

Conversely, one could argue that the prevalence of sites like HD4U acts as an unintended form of market pressure on Hollywood. For decades, the film industry was slow to adapt to digital demands, clinging to physical media and rigid release windows. The rise of free streaming sites forced Hollywood to innovate. The proliferation of legitimate streaming services, the adoption of simultaneous releases on home video, and the improvement of digital rights management (DRM) were all accelerated by the industry’s need to compete with the convenience of piracy. In this sense, HD4U serves as a disruptive competitor, pushing Hollywood to improve the user experience for paying customers by offering better interfaces, exclusive content, and higher bitrates.

If you are looking for an academic "paper" or a comprehensive report regarding the Hollywood film industry's transition to 4K/UHD and digital distribution, the following overview covers the industry standards, technical requirements, and legal platforms. 📽️ Hollywood Digital Distribution: The Shift to 4K UHD 1. Technical Standards for "HD4U" Quality

To achieve true "High Definition for You," Hollywood studios follow strict technical specifications to ensure cinematic quality reaches home screens. Resolution:

4K UHD (3840 x 2160 pixels) is the current standard for premium home viewing. HDR (High Dynamic Range): Technologies like Dolby Vision enhance color depth and contrast.

High-quality streams require 15–25 Mbps, while physical 4K Blu-rays provide up to 100 Mbps for lossless detail. Frame Rate: Most Hollywood films are shot at

, though digital distribution supports higher rates for sports and gaming. 2. Legal Platforms for Hollywood Content

Using official sources ensures the highest security and playback quality. Movies Anywhere: Digital Locker Service that syncs purchases from Amazon, Apple, and Google. Netflix / Disney+ / Max:

Subscription models that offer massive libraries of 4K Hollywood "blockbusters." Google Play & Apple TV:

The industry leaders for renting or buying individual digital copies in 4K. 3. Industry Challenges: Piracy vs. Accessibility

Sites often labeled "HD4U" or similar are frequently unauthorized. The industry combats this through: Windowing:

Reducing the time between theater release and digital "Home Premiere." Pricing Models:

Offering ad-supported tiers to lower the barrier for consumers. DRM (Digital Rights Management): Sophisticated encryption used by Google Play and others to prevent unauthorized copying. 📄 Summary Table: Quality Comparison Standard HD (1080p) 4K UHD (2160p) Pixel Count ~2 million ~8 million Color Depth 8-bit (SDR) 10 or 12-bit (HDR) Best Source Standard Streaming 4K Blu-ray / Apple TV 4K Experience Clear, standard detail Sharp, lifelike textures
